Got a old "NOS" electric washer pump for the delay wiper motor today & need to make a change in how the instructions required cutting some wires. This involves the red & black/purple (they list it as pink/black) wires. The red has a Packard flag (90 deg) terminal & the black/purple is soldered onto the relay
It is instructed to cut & splice them together but in my wire OCD I can't. So now I need to find some of those Packard flag terminals that will allow me to use the new pump & revert back to the mechanical pump. I think it was a bad idea for GM to solder the one wire instead of using a flag terminal but using one on that wire will allow a cleaner conversion & still allow it to go back to OE setup minus solder. I have some double male blade terminals that'll allow them to connect, just need a shrink tube to insulate. I do want to show this as it might help with replacing the relay also.
